Electronic music producer and performer Alec Empire, who is currently touring Europe with Nine Inch Nails, recently started remixing a song by Austin electro-punk band POSR.
POSR signed a record deal with Houston’s Tierra Studios in May and plans to release the single “Fantasy,” as well as Empire’s remix, in October. The single will give music fans a taste of the dark beats, raw bass and self-perceptive lyrics of POSR’s debut album, Known Unknown.
Jake Childs, the producer, songwriter and vocalist behind POSR, said he chose to approach Empire for a remix because of his work in the 1990s with Atari Teenage Riot. The innovative band is accredited with creating the digital hardcore subgenre, characterized by hard breakbeats, punk-influenced guitar riffs and ear-ripping noise.
“Alec Empire has been a huge influence on the electro-punk movement,” Childs said. “I feel very honored that he would remix ‘Fantasy.’ I can’t wait for this, and I know he’ll do a really good job, because he’s Alec Empire.”
In addition to Empire’s fame from touring the world with Atari Teenage Riot, he is an accomplished producer and solo performer under multiple monikers. He founded Digital Hardcore Recordings and Eat Your Heart Out Records, and has toured alongside world-renowned artists such as Wu-Tang Clan, Rage Against The Machine and Ministry. A prolific artist, Empire has released an album nearly every year since 1992, including the 2009-released album Shivers.
“I always look for new and exciting projects and bands because I love wrapping my mind around a musical idea. I create from there before it’s established everywhere,” Empire said. “I get sent a lot of remix requests, but I only do it when the music jumps at me and I feel that I can bring out another side of the artist. With POSR this was the case, no doubt.”
POSR’s music and lyrics are characterized by Childs’ explorations into the duality of self: good vs. evil, right vs. wrong, the conscious vs. the unconscious personalities that exist simultaneously in a sometimes schizophrenic-like state. Childs, who also enjoys a successful career touring the globe as a tech-house DJ, is joined in the electro-punk band by Illson on “dirty” bass and guitar, Chris Casual on “clean” bass, and Adam Warped playing keys and DJing a laptop loaded with original synths and drums that Childs produced.
POSR executive producer Traey Hatch of Tierra Studios said he views Alec Empire’s involvement as a tribute to electro-punk music’s history and a blessing from the artist who continues to innovate in the genre.
“Alec’s music has moved butts and assaulted crowds all over the globe, and we’re truly excited to hear what he has in store for POSR,” Hatch said. “This will give ‘Fantasy’ and the Known Unknown album some immediate recognition and credibility because it exposes POSR to people who have loved Alec’s music for a long time.”

Tierra Records and Tierra Music Publishing announced today it has signed producer Jake Child’s new electro-punk project POSR. POSR brings together Jakes’ considerable production experience and his goal of creating a complete artist identity. Production and mastering will commence immediately with the goal of releasing POSR, in the US, in late September. POSR is currently finishing the mixes on a number of songs before final mastering. Pre-release and press copies are scheduled to be out late-June. PR team, radio promotional team and street marketing partners will be announced along with pre-release copies of the record.
